A collection of essays edited by Professor Salwak whose publications include literary biographies of John Wain and A.J.Cronin. He also wrote reference guides to Kingsley Amis, John Braine, A.J.Cronin, Carl Sandburg and John Wain.

Dale Salwak is Professor of English at Southern California's Citrus College and the leading bibliographer of works by and about Kingsley Amis.
